Optimize performance of TCP-based applications across your WAN with Cisco WAAS, which combines application acceleration technologies with WAN optimization techniques. The WAAS solution allows you to confidently deploy centralized applications; consolidate costly branch office servers and storage into data centers; and offer LAN-like performance to remote users.
Unlike other WAN optimization solutions, WAAS integrates transparently with the network, preserving TCP information to maintain functions such as security, QoS, visibility, and monitoring. WAAS is easy to deploy and manage, and integrates with Cisco IOS Software.
To accelerate application and file performance and to reduce WAN bandwidth usage, Cisco WAAS incorporates application acceleration and WAN optimization techniques, including compression, redundancy elimination, transport optimizations, caching, and content distribution. These techniques help overcome the bandwidth, throughput, and latency limitations associated with TCP/IP and application protocols.
